Code U2616 2015 GMC Sierra Description

Devices connected to the serial data circuits monitor for serial data communications during normal vehicle operation. Operating information and commands are exchanged among the devices. The devices have prerecorded information about what messages are needed to be exchanged on the serial data circuits, for each virtual network. The messages are supervised and also, some periodic messages are used by the receiver device as an availability indication of the transmitter device. Each message contains the identification number of the transmitter device. The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) will be set when a supervised periodic message that includes the transmitter device availability has not been received.

U2616 2015 GMC Sierra Code - Fuel Pump Driver Control Module Lost Communication With ECM

What are the Possible Causes of the DTC U2616 2015 GMC Sierra?

  • Faulty Engine Control Module (ECM)
  • Engine Control Module harness is open or shorted
  • Engine Control Module circuit poor electrical connection
  • Faulty Fuel Pump Driver Control Module

How to Fix the DTC U2616 2015 GMC Sierra?

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

What is the Cost to Diagnose the Code?

Labor: 1.0

To diagnose the U2616 2015 GMC Sierra code, it typically requires 1.0 hour of labor. Rates vary by location, vehicle, and shop. Many shops charge between $80–$150 per hour; dealerships and metro areas may be higher, independents may be lower.

Frequently Asked Questions about U2616 2015 GMC Sierra Code

1. What are the common symptoms of OBDII code U2616 in a 2015 GMC Sierra?

The common symptoms include issues with the fuel pump operation, stalling, rough idling, difficulty starting the vehicle, and illuminated warning lights on the dashboard.

2. What causes the OBDII code U2616 in a 2015 GMC Sierra?

This code is typically triggered when there is a communication breakdown between the Fuel Pump Driver Control Module (FDCM) and the Engine Control Module (ECM) in the vehicle.

3. How can I diagnose the U2616 code in my 2015 GMC Sierra?

Diagnosing this code usually involves checking for loose or damaged wiring connections between the FDCM and ECM, testing the communication circuits, and verifying the functionality of both modules.

4. Can a faulty fuel pump trigger the U2616 code in a 2015 GMC Sierra?

While a faulty fuel pump can lead to related symptoms, the U2616 code specifically points to a communication issue between the FDCM and ECM, rather than a problem with the fuel pump itself.
